Comparison of the analgesic efficacy of combined superficial and deep serratus anterior plane block versus pectoserratus plane block following modified radical mastectomy surgery
Abstract Background Both the pectoserratus plane block and the combined deep and superficial serratus anterior plane block (CSAPB) are recognized as effective regional anesthesia methods for pain control.
